radioactive placard
Class 7 covers radioactive materials that emit ionising radiation — uranium, radium, medical isotopes and industrial radiography sources. The diamond, yellow above and white below with the three-blade trefoil, flags a hazard that cannot be seen or smelled, and one whose control rests on distance, time and shielding.
Where is it used and when is it required?
Applied to shielded packages, drums and containers, on the doors of chemical stores and source rooms, in warehouses in industrial cities and at weld-radiography sites, on trucks carrying dangerous goods, and in laboratories and nuclear-medicine departments.
Regulation notes
GHS, the Globally Harmonized System of Classification and Labelling of Chemicals, is the classification system adopted across the Gulf, and the placard's colours, symbol and class number all derive from it; for radioactive material the national nuclear regulator's oversight applies on top of it. Placarding stores, containers and vehicles is the expected practice in Saudi and UAE industrial zones whenever dangerous goods are stored or moved.
- The usual placard size on trucks and containers is 250 × 250 mm; a 100 × 100 mm label is enough on a single shielded package.
- Print on a weatherproof, UV-resistant material — the placard stays on the package for the whole journey and in open holding yards.
- Keep the class number "7" at the bottom corner clear, and never write over the contents and activity boxes printed on the package label.
